Popular Post webfact Posted March 15 Popular Post Posted March 15 Pictures courtesy of Daily News Thai police launched a nighttime operation in Soi Nana, part of Bangkok's bustling Sukhumvit area, leading to the arrest of 13 foreign women suspected of engaging in sex work. The operation, which took place on 13th March under the direction of Police Major General Siam Boonsom and other senior officers, targeted illegal solicitations following reports of suspicious activities in the locality. Officers from the Lumpini police station, in partnership with the Ministry of Social Development and Human Security, swept the area. Among the detainees were women from Tanzania, Uzbekistan, and Vietnam. They were apprehended on charges linked to public nuisance and suspected involvement in prostitution, a breach of local laws intended to curb such practices in public areas. During the raid, the authorities also identified 10 individuals begging on the streets, comprising Thai nationals and Cambodians, some with children. They faced separate fines, while the children were put under protective care. These efforts form part of a broader initiative aimed at restoring public order and addressing concerns over illegal activities in one of Bangkok's busy nightlife districts. The arrested women have been forwarded to the Lumpini police station for legal proceedings.
